HIP 1881
HIP 1881 is a G-type (Yellow) star.
Located approximately 354.1 light-years from Earth, HIP 1881 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.
HIP 1881 is classified as a spectral class G star (G-type (Yellow)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.
At an apparent magnitude of +10.78, HIP 1881 is a faint star that requires a telescope to observe. It is invisible to the naked eye and too dim for most binoculars. Observers will note its yellow-white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.600.
